当前位置:首页 > 综合资讯 > 正文
黑狐家游戏

免费kvm主机管理系统,深入解析免费KVM主机管理系统,功能、优势与使用指南

免费kvm主机管理系统,深入解析免费KVM主机管理系统,功能、优势与使用指南

免费KVM主机管理系统深入解析,全面介绍其功能、优势及使用指南,系统具备强大性能,操作简便,支持多种虚拟化技术,助您轻松管理虚拟主机。...

免费KVM主机管理系统深入解析,全面介绍其功能、优势及使用指南,系统具备强大性能,操作简便,支持多种虚拟化技术,助您轻松管理虚拟主机。

随着云计算技术的飞速发展,虚拟化技术已成为企业数据中心的核心技术之一,KVM(Kernel-based Virtual Machine)作为一种开源的虚拟化技术,因其高性能、低成本和易于扩展等优势,在国内外得到了广泛的应用,本文将深入解析免费KVM主机管理系统,包括其功能、优势以及使用指南,帮助读者更好地了解和使用KVM主机管理系统。

KVM主机管理系统概述

KVM简介

免费kvm主机管理系统,深入解析免费KVM主机管理系统,功能、优势与使用指南

图片来源于网络,如有侵权联系删除

KVM(Kernel-based Virtual Machine)是一种基于Linux内核的虚拟化技术,它允许用户在单个物理服务器上运行多个虚拟机(VM),KVM通过修改Linux内核,实现了硬件虚拟化,从而提高了虚拟机的性能和稳定性。

KVM主机管理系统简介

KVM主机管理系统是一种用于管理KVM虚拟机的软件平台,它可以帮助管理员轻松地创建、配置、监控和管理虚拟机,目前市面上有许多免费的KVM主机管理系统,如Libvirt、OpenStack、Proxmox VE等。

KVM主机管理系统功能

虚拟机管理

(1)创建虚拟机:管理员可以创建不同类型的虚拟机,如Windows、Linux等,并配置CPU、内存、硬盘等资源。

(2)克隆虚拟机:管理员可以将现有虚拟机克隆成新的虚拟机,节省创建新虚拟机的时间。

(3)迁移虚拟机:管理员可以将虚拟机从一个物理服务器迁移到另一个物理服务器,实现负载均衡。

(4)扩展虚拟机资源:管理员可以根据需要为虚拟机添加或删除CPU、内存、硬盘等资源。

存储管理

(1)创建存储池:管理员可以创建存储池,将硬盘或LVM卷等存储资源分配给虚拟机。

(2)挂载存储:管理员可以将存储池中的存储资源挂载到虚拟机中。

(3)备份与恢复:管理员可以对虚拟机进行备份和恢复,确保数据安全。

网络管理

(1)创建网络:管理员可以创建虚拟网络,为虚拟机提供网络连接。

(2)配置网络:管理员可以为虚拟机配置IP地址、子网掩码、网关等网络参数。

(3)端口转发:管理员可以将虚拟机的网络端口映射到物理服务器的网络端口。

监控与告警

(1)实时监控:管理员可以实时监控虚拟机的CPU、内存、硬盘、网络等资源使用情况。

(2)告警设置:管理员可以设置告警阈值,当资源使用超过阈值时,系统会自动发送告警信息。

KVM主机管理系统优势

  1. 开源免费:KVM主机管理系统是开源软件,用户可以免费使用和修改。

    免费kvm主机管理系统,深入解析免费KVM主机管理系统,功能、优势与使用指南

    图片来源于网络,如有侵权联系删除

  2. 高性能:KVM基于硬件虚拟化,虚拟机性能接近物理机。

  3. 易于扩展:KVM主机管理系统支持横向扩展,可以轻松增加物理服务器和虚拟机。

  4. 灵活配置:管理员可以根据需求自定义虚拟机配置,满足不同业务场景。

  5. 兼容性强:KVM主机管理系统支持多种操作系统和虚拟化技术,兼容性良好。

KVM主机管理系统使用指南

环境准备

(1)操作系统:选择支持KVM的Linux发行版,如CentOS、Ubuntu等。

(2)硬件要求:确保物理服务器满足KVM运行要求,如CPU支持虚拟化技术等。

安装KVM主机管理系统

以Libvirt为例,安装步骤如下:

(1)安装Libvirt软件包:

sudo yum install libvirt-python libvirt-python-modprobe

(2)启动并使能Libvirt服务:

sudo systemctl start libvirtd
sudo systemctl enable libvirtd

(3)配置防火墙:

sudo firewall-cmd --permanent --add-port=16509-16609/tcp
sudo firewall-cmd --reload

创建虚拟机

(1)创建虚拟机XML配置文件:

<domain type='kvm'>
  <name>vm1</name>
  <memory unit='GiB'>2</memory>
  <vcpu placement='static'>2</vcpu>
  <os>
    <type arch='x86_64' machine='pc-i440fx-2.9'>hvm</type>
    <boot dev='hd'/>
  </os>
  <devices>
    <disk type='file' device='disk'>
      <driver name='qemu' type='qcow2'/>
      <source file='/var/lib/libvirt/images/vm1.qcow2'/>
      <target dev='vda' bus='virtio'/>
    </disk>
    <interface type='bridge'>
      <source bridge='br0'/>
      <model type='virtio'/>
    </interface>
  </devices>
</domain>

(2)导入虚拟机:

virt-install --name vm1 --ram 2048 --vcpus 2 --disk path=/var/lib/libvirt/images/vm1.qcow2,size=20 --os-type linux --os-variant ubuntu18.04 --network bridge=br0,model=virtio --graphics none --console pty,target_type=serial

管理虚拟机

(1)启动虚拟机:

virsh start vm1

(2)关闭虚拟机:

virsh shutdown vm1

(3)查看虚拟机状态:

virsh list --all

本文深入解析了免费KVM主机管理系统,包括其功能、优势和使用指南,KVM主机管理系统具有开源免费、高性能、易于扩展等优势,是云计算数据中心不可或缺的技术,希望本文能帮助读者更好地了解和使用KVM主机管理系统。

黑狐家游戏

发表评论

最新文章